OpenCHAT是一款基于HTTP与HTML技术构建的聊天服务器解决方案,其显著特点在于用户仅需通过常规网页浏览器即可轻松接入聊天服务,无需额外安装任何Applet或软件。为了帮助开发者更好地掌握OpenCHAT的应用方法,本文提供了几个实用的代码示例,展示如何利用OpenCHAT的HTTP接口实现基本的聊天功能。
OpenCHAT, 聊天服务器, HTTP接口, HTML技术, 代码示例
OpenCHAT作为一款高效的聊天服务器解决方案,其技术架构主要依赖于HTTP协议和HTML技术。这种设计使得OpenCHAT能够轻松地集成到现有的Web环境中,无需用户安装额外的客户端软件。下面详细介绍OpenCHAT的核心技术架构:
OpenCHAT凭借其独特的优势,在众多聊天服务器解决方案中脱颖而出:
综上所述,OpenCHAT以其简单易用、高度兼容和易于集成的特点,成为了现代聊天服务器领域的一个优秀选择。
OpenCHAT作为一种先进的聊天服务器解决方案,为用户和开发者带来了诸多优势:
与传统的聊天服务器相比,OpenCHAT展现出了明显的优势:
综上所述,OpenCHAT以其独特的技术架构和设计理念,在易用性、跨平台兼容性、安全性等方面展现出了显著的优势,成为了现代聊天服务器领域的一个重要选择。
信息可能包含敏感信息。
OpenCHAT通过其强大的HTTP接口,为开发者提供了实现基本聊天功能的基础。以下是一些关键功能的实现方式:
POST /login
请求进行用户登录操作。POST /messages/send
请求发送消息。GET /messages/receive
请求接收新消息。GET /messages/offline
请求获取离线消息。通过上述API调用,开发者可以构建完整的聊天功能,包括登录、发送消息、接收消息以及处理离线消息等。
为了更好地理解如何使用OpenCHAT的HTTP接口,下面提供了一些具体的代码示例。
// JavaScript示例代码
const axios = require('axios');
async function login(username, password) {
const response = await axios.post('https://openchat.example.com/login', {
username: username,
password: password
});
if (response.status === 200) {
console.log('登录成功');
return response.data.sessionId;
} else {
console.error('登录失败');
return null;
}
}
// 调用登录函数
login('example_user', 'password123').then(sessionId => {
console.log('会话ID:', sessionId);
});
async function sendMessage(sessionId, recipient, message) {
const response = await axios.post('https://openchat.example.com/messages/send', {
sessionId: sessionId,
recipient: recipient,
message: message
});
if (response.status === 200) {
console.log('消息发送成功');
} else {
console.error('消息发送失败');
}
}
// 假设已获得sessionId
sendMessage('sessionId123', 'recipient_user', '你好!').then(() => {
console.log('消息已发送');
});
async function receiveMessages(sessionId) {
const response = await axios.get(`https://openchat.example.com/messages/receive?sessionId=${sessionId}`);
if (response.status === 200) {
console.log('接收到的消息:', response.data.messages);
} else {
console.error('接收消息失败');
}
}
// 假设已获得sessionId
receiveMessages('sessionId123').then(() => {
console.log('消息已接收');
});
以上代码示例展示了如何使用OpenCHAT的HTTP接口实现基本的聊天功能,包括登录、发送消息和接收消息。通过这些示例,开发者可以快速上手并开始构建自己的聊天应用。
随着互联网技术的不断发展和普及,即时通讯已成为人们日常生活中不可或缺的一部分。OpenCHAT作为一种基于HTTP和HTML技术的聊天服务器解决方案,凭借其易用性、跨平台兼容性和安全性等特点,在未来的应用前景十分广阔。
随着技术的进步和社会需求的变化,OpenCHAT的应用场景将会越来越广泛,为各行各业带来更多的便利和发展机遇。
OpenCHAT作为一种新兴的聊天服务器解决方案,其未来发展将呈现出以下几个趋势:
总之,OpenCHAT作为一种高效且易于部署的聊天服务器解决方案,将在未来展现出更大的发展潜力和广阔的市场前景。
通过本文的介绍,我们深入了解了OpenCHAT作为一种基于HTTP与HTML技术的聊天服务器解决方案的独特之处。OpenCHAT不仅简化了用户的接入流程,还为开发者提供了丰富的RESTful API,使得集成和开发变得更加简单快捷。从易用性、跨平台兼容性到安全性等多个方面,OpenCHAT展现出了显著的优势,尤其是在无需安装额外客户端软件这一点上,极大地提升了用户体验。此外,通过具体的代码示例,我们看到了如何利用OpenCHAT的HTTP接口实现基本的聊天功能,包括登录、发送消息、接收消息等。展望未来,OpenCHAT的应用前景十分广阔,无论是教育领域、企业协作还是社交网络,都有着巨大的潜力等待挖掘。随着技术的不断进步和功能的持续拓展,OpenCHAT将成为更多行业和场景中的首选聊天服务器解决方案。